About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• The Equipment Operator is responsible for operating various types of machinery to support right of way vegetation maintenance and clearance around power lines.
  • Loads and unloads vehicles and equipment from a trailer.
  • Responsible for proper load securement in accordance with company policies, approved work methods and FMCSA regulations.
  • Works on the ground using hand saws, ground saws or other applicable tools to cut brush, limbs and logs of larger trees.
  • Utilizes a variety of tools (i.e., rake, shovel, leaf blower) to remove debris from work area.
  • Gathers manageable size brush, limbs and logs and carries to the designated chipping area.
  • Operates heavy machinery such as boom trimmers or mowers, excavators, tub grinder, feller-buncher, etc.
  • Adheres to and helps educate less experienced employees on company policies, on-the-job safety practices, approved work methods and OSHA regulations.
  • Uses applicable herbicide equipment to treat stumps and brush.
  • Maintain appropriate application records.
  • Applies herbicide and growth regulators to brush and stumps.
  • Works around hazardous equipment and in close proximity to energized power lines.
  • Conducts pre-inspection of work area to identify potential hazards.
  • Loads vehicles and equipment with manageable size limbs and logs not suited for wood chipping.
  • Sets up warning signs, barriers, flags, relays hand-signals, directs traffic and other applicable traffic control devices to protect employees and members of the public from hazards in and around the work area.
  • Cooperates with property owner, customer, and emergency personnel when blocking streets or driveways.
  • Conducts vehicle and equipment inspections to ensure proper working conditions.
  • Reports specialized vehicle maintenance or equipment needs to General Foreperson.
  • During emergencies or natural disasters may be required to be on duty and travel outside of regular work location for the duration of the disaster.
  • Assists with contacting and coordinating the crew’s response to such work and responsible for determining proper steps necessary to eliminate hazards and trim/remove trees while onsite during emergency response.

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• High School diploma or equivalent preferred, but not required.
  • Must have valid First-Aid and CPR cards or ability to obtain within 90 days of hire.
  • Ability to operate heavy equipment such as boom trimmers or mowers, excavators, tub grinder, feller-buncher, etc.
  • Knowledge of trees, including identification, growth habits and arboricultural techniques specific to trimming, pruning, repairing, maintaining and removing, in close proximity to energized conductors.
  • Knowledge and understanding of the American National Standards for Tree Care Operations (ANSI Z133.1-current version).
  • Ability to adhere and coach employees on company and industry safety requirements.
  • Knowledge of electrical circuits and skilled in reading and understanding of circuit maps.
  • Knowledge of OSHA electric power generation, transmission, and distribution standards.
  • Ability to determine nominal voltage, proper use of insulated tools near energized parts and distinguish exposed live parts from other parts of electric equipment.
  • Ability to learn quickly and to follow instructions accurately.
  • Must be able to communicate with others and represent Wright Tree Service in a professional manner.
  • Must be able to comprehend and/or read and write both written and verbal job instructions and safety information.
  • Ability to recognize poisonous plants and take proper safeguard against them.
  • Must be able to wear necessary personal protective equipment (PPE) as required.
  • Ability to work long hours and overtime during emergencies (including holidays, weekends, storm work) and will be subject to call-out work.
  • Demonstrate knowledge and trained to perform tree and bucket rescue.
  • Ability to operate and service all required tools and equipment.
  • Ability to work both independently and in a group.
